Browse Source

规则基类更新

rengb 5 years ago
parent
commit
d0a713954c

+ 5 - 8
kernel/src/main/java/com/lantone/qc/kernel/catalogue/behospitalized/BEH0001.java

@@ -20,26 +20,23 @@ import java.util.List;
 public class BEH0001 extends QCCatalogue {
 public class BEH0001 extends QCCatalogue {
     public void start(InputInfo inputInfo, OutputInfo outputInfo) {
     public void start(InputInfo inputInfo, OutputInfo outputInfo) {
 
 
-        String status = "0";
-        String infos = "";
+        status = "0";
         List<Clinical> clinicals = inputInfo.getBeHospitalizedDoc().getChiefLabel().getClinicals();
         List<Clinical> clinicals = inputInfo.getBeHospitalizedDoc().getChiefLabel().getClinicals();
         if(clinicals.size()>0){
         if(clinicals.size()>0){
             for (Clinical clinical:clinicals) {
             for (Clinical clinical:clinicals) {
                 String clinicalName = clinical.getName();
                 String clinicalName = clinical.getName();
                 List<PD> timestamp = clinical.getTimestamp();
                 List<PD> timestamp = clinical.getTimestamp();
                 if(timestamp == null){
                 if(timestamp == null){
-                    if(StringUtils.isEmpty(infos)){
-                        infos = clinicalName;
+                    if(StringUtils.isEmpty(info)){
+                        info = clinicalName;
                     }else {
                     }else {
-                        infos = infos+","+clinicalName;
+                        info = info+","+clinicalName;
                     }
                     }
                 }
                 }
             }
             }
         }
         }
-        if(StringUtils.isNotEmpty(infos)){
+        if(StringUtils.isNotEmpty(info)){
             status = "-1";
             status = "-1";
         }
         }
-        resultDetail.put("status",status);
-        resultDetail.put("info",infos);
     }
     }
 }
 }

+ 1 - 4
kernel/src/main/java/com/lantone/qc/kernel/catalogue/behospitalized/BEH0003.java

@@ -22,14 +22,11 @@ import java.util.List;
 public class BEH0003 extends QCCatalogue {
 public class BEH0003 extends QCCatalogue {
     public void start(InputInfo inputInfo, OutputInfo outputInfo) {
     public void start(InputInfo inputInfo, OutputInfo outputInfo) {
 
 
-        String status = "0";
-        String infos = "";
+        status = "0";
         String chief_text = inputInfo.getBeHospitalizedDoc().getChiefLabel().getText();
         String chief_text = inputInfo.getBeHospitalizedDoc().getChiefLabel().getText();
         if(CatalogueUtil.removeSpecialChar(chief_text).length()>20)
         if(CatalogueUtil.removeSpecialChar(chief_text).length()>20)
         {
         {
             status = "-1";
             status = "-1";
         }
         }
-        resultDetail.put("status",status);
-        resultDetail.put("info",infos);
     }
     }
 }
 }